Most China Southern premium flyers at PEN get sent next door

FlyerTalk reports China Southern passengers at Penang (PEN T1) are usually routed to the Plaza Premium Lounge, not the China Southern Sky Pearl Lounge. That lines up with reports that Plaza Premium also handles business-class guests for Malaysia Airlines, Qatar Airways, SilkAir/Singapore, Air China, and others in the same area.

The Sky Pearl Lounge sits airside in Terminal 1, but current trip reports focus almost entirely on the Plaza Premium next door. One FlyerTalk user flat-out calls Sky Pearl a shared business facility “for Malaysian, Qatar, Silk, China, China Southern, etc.”, yet recent Cathay flyers say CX now directs all passengers to the adjacent Plaza Premium instead.

Opening hours for Sky Pearl are not clearly published online, while Plaza Premium at PEN typically runs from early morning to late evening to cover QR, MH, and CZ bank times. Because airlines actively send passengers to Plaza Premium, treat Sky Pearl as secondary and expect staff at the check-in desk or gate to issue you a Plaza Premium invitation first.

There’s no reliable, recent data on food, drinks, showers, or seating in the China Southern Sky Pearl Lounge at Penang, and no specific dish, drink brand, or seat type gets mentioned in current reviews. By contrast, travellers routinely review Plaza Premium’s hot food line, drink station and seating density, which is another clue about where people actually end up.

Regulars on FlyerTalk and Reddit say they follow airline instructions and walk straight into Plaza Premium when flying Cathay, Qatar, or China Southern from T1. One poster notes Cathay Pacific “now sends all guests to the adjacent Plaza Premium lounge next door,” so if you’re on CX or another oneworld carrier, don’t waste time hunting for a separate Sky Pearl-branded door.

Watch out for: outdated references on old lounge maps or in apps that still list China Southern Sky Pearl Lounge as a standalone option at PEN without mentioning Plaza Premium. If your boarding pass or lounge card doesn’t clearly say “China Southern Sky Pearl Lounge,” assume Plaza Premium is where you’re expected.

Practical tip: at check-in in T1, ask the agent which lounge your flight actually uses and get explicit directions; if they say Plaza Premium, follow that and skip wandering around trying to find Sky Pearl signage.
